Roof repair costs depend on a few key factors. First, the size of the damaged area matters, as does the specific type of roofing material you have, like shingles, tile, or metal. If there is underlying structural rot or water damage to the wood decking, that adds to the scope of work. Accessibility also plays a role—steep roofs or those requiring specialized equipment to reach safely can increase labor time. We also consider the complexity of the vents, chimneys, or skylights involved in the repair.
Commercial roofing services address the specific needs of flat or low-slope roofs found on businesses and industrial buildings. These roofs require specialized materials like TPO, EPDM, or modified bitumen to handle heavy water flow and ponding. Corrugated metal roofing is durable and can withstand Colorado Springs' weather well, including hail and wind. It’s often a good choice for its longevity. However, installation needs to be done by experienced pros to ensure it's watertight. Noise can be a factor during heavy rain or hail. The upfront cost might be higher than asphalt shingles. Roof cleaning in Colorado Springs can help extend the life of your roof. It removes moss, algae, and debris that can trap moisture. Trapped moisture can lead to rot and damage. Regular cleaning prevents these issues from becoming costly repairs. It also improves the curb appeal of your home. You can get advice on whether your roof needs cleaning. Rubber roofing, often used for flat or low-slope roofs, is a durable and waterproof option suitable for Colorado Springs. It handles temperature fluctuations well and resists UV damage. It's a practical choice for certain building types. Installation requires specialized knowledge to ensure a watertight seal.
